2017 CWF Alimagnet Lake Stormwater Improvement Projects
The Vermillion River Watershed Joint Powers Organization, in partnership with the City of Burnsville, is planning an overall improvement in the Alimagnet Lake subwatershed that consists retrofit two existing stormwater ponds that drain to Alimagnet Lake, a nutrient impaired water, with iron-enhanced sand filter benches. It is estimated that a significant amount of phosphorus reduction will be achieved by implementing this project, bringing Alimagnet Lake closer to state water quality standards.

This project will result in a reduction of 62 pounds of phosphorus/year.
This project resulted in an estimated annual reduction of 74.4 lbs of phosphorus.
